We discuss the application of coded modulation for power-line communications. We combine M-ary FSK with diversity and coding to make the transmission robust against permanent frequency disturbances and impulse noise. We give a particular example of the coding/modulation scheme that is in agreement with the existing CENELEC norms. The scheme can be considered as a form of coded Frequency Hopping...

This study describes a human foot bone assemblage from prehistoric Mangaia, Cook Islands in the context of diaphyseal cross-sectional strength measures. We use this sample to test the hypothesis that habitually unshod individuals who walk over rugged terrain will have stronger foot bones than a sample of habitually shod industrialized people. Specifically, we examine whether the Mangaian sample...

AIMS Activation of cAMP signalling abrogates thrombin-induced hyperpermeability. One of the mechanisms underlying this protective effect is the inactivation of endothelial contractile machinery, one of the major determinants of endothelial barrier function, mainly via the activation of myosin light chain phosphatase (MLCP). To date, the mechanisms of cAMP-mediated MLCP activation are only parti...

cAMP induces both active Cl(-) and active K(+) secretion in mammalian colon. It is generally assumed that a mechanism for K(+) exit is essential to maintain cells in the hyperpolarized state, thus favoring a sustained Cl(-) secretion. Both Kcnn4c and Kcnma1 channels are located in colon, and this study addressed the questions of whether Kcnn4c and/or Kcnma1 channels mediate cAMP-induced K(+) se...
